Carragher is Liverpool's saviour

If not for defensive lynchpin Jamie Carragher, Liverpool would have folded at the Merseyside derby, believes Ian Rush.

The Reds managed to come away with a clean sheet and unscathed thanks to an inspired performance by Liverpool's stalwart defending that thwarted the waves of Everton's raids.

Speaking to The Liverpool Echo the former Liverpool striker is a firm believer that the defender's performance will get the critics of his back.

"Jamie Carragher was outstanding in Sunday's derby.

"He epitomised the attitude and commitment in the Liverpool side and you could see how desperate he was to get the three points.

"He put his head in when it hurts and was everywhere, fighting for possession, determined to ensure Everton didn't get back in the game.

"He took some stick earlier in the season but Sunday proved he's back to his best."
